The Cultural and Economic Impacts
The consequences of balancing government budgets can be far-reaching, touching on various aspects of society and the economy. In times of economic downturn, governments may implement austerity measures to reduce spending, which can have a ripple effect on businesses, employment, and individual incomes.
On the other hand, a balanced budget can foster economic stability, allowing governments to invest in public services, infrastructure, and social programs that benefit the population. This, in turn, can contribute to increased economic growth, job creation, and improved standards of living.

So, how do governments go about balancing their budgets? The process typically involves a combination of strategic planning, fiscal discipline, and effective resource allocation. Here are the key steps:
- Step 1: Establishing Clear Objectives - Governments set out to define their priorities and goals, which serve as the foundation for their budgeting decisions.
- Step 2: Assessing Revenue Streams - Governments identify and calculate their available revenue, including tax revenues, fees, and other sources of income.
- Step 3: Allocating Resources - Governments decide how to distribute their resources across various sectors, such as defense, education, healthcare, and infrastructure.
- Step 4: Prioritizing Spending - Governments identify essential spending areas, such as social security, pensions, and debt service, and allocate funds accordingly.
- Step 5: Controlling Expenditures - Governments implement measures to reduce waste, optimize resource usage, and contain costs.
- Step 6: Managing Debt - Governments aim to reduce their debt burden through a combination of fiscal discipline and strategic debt management.
- Step 7: Monitoring and Adjusting - Governments continuously assess their budget performance, making adjustments as needed to ensure a balanced and sustainable fiscal position.
